About Rapayan
Rapayan is a small town in Peru (Ancash) with a population of 801. The city sits at an elevation of 10,755 feet (3,278 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 34°F (1°C). Temperatures range from 34°F in January to 33°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 52.1 inches. The timezone is America/Lima.
